Denmark - Road Freight Volume of Man-Made Fibers, Nuclear Fuel, Chemicals, Rubber, Plastic and Chemical Products

Since 2014, Denmark Road Freight Volume of Man-Made Fibers, Nuclear Fuel, Chemicals, Rubber, Plastic and Chemical Products rose 2.5% year on year. With 3,760 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was ranked number 20 among other countries in Road Freight Volume of Man-Made Fibers, Nuclear Fuel, Chemicals, Rubber, Plastic and Chemical Products. Denmark is overtaken by Slovenia, which was number 19 at 3,857 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Austria at 3,469 Thousand Metric Tons. Germany ranked the highest with 134,131 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is -4.8% compared to 2018. Spain, Poland and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lithuania recorded the best 5 years average growth at +13.2% per year, while Hungary recorded the worst performance at -16.1% per year.
